Foros del Web » Creando para Internet » HTML »

centrar mi web

Estas en el tema de centrar mi web en el foro de HTML en Foros del Web. Hola a todos y feliz año nuevo. Mi duda es la siguiente, yo he hecho una web para verla bien en 800x600, pero la he ...
  #1 (permalink)  
Antiguo 05/01/2005, 02:45
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
centrar mi web

Hola a todos y feliz año nuevo.
Mi duda es la siguiente, yo he hecho una web para verla bien en 800x600, pero la he centrado con la etiqueta <center> para cuando se vea a una resolución mayor. Lo que ocurre es que esa etiqueta me la centra en cuanto al margen izquierdo y derecho, y quiero centrarla completamente, hay alguna forma de centrarla en cuanto al margen superior e inferior?

Muchas gracias
  #2 (permalink)  
Antiguo 05/01/2005, 03:36
Avatar de RUX
RUX
 
Fecha de Ingreso: enero-2004
Ubicación: Las Palmas de Gran Canari
Mensajes: 566
Antigüedad: 20 años, 3 meses
Puntos: 0
Si te refieres a que se ajuste a la resolucion de la pantalla o que se redimensione segun abras el navegador tienes que ajustar el width de tu <table... en porcentaje, Ejemplo:
<table width="100%" border="0" align="center">

Para un ajuste vertical valign="top" (arriba)
o bien valign="middle" (centro) o valign="bottom". (abajo).

Espero haberte ayudado
SALUDOS
__________________
Rux.es - Sitio Personal | IslaRock.com - Todo Rock
  #3 (permalink)  
Antiguo 05/01/2005, 06:36
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
gracias rux, creo que es lo de valign="middle"
  #4 (permalink)  
Antiguo 05/01/2005, 06:55
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
rux he probado lo de valign="middle" pero no veo resultado alguno, puede ser porque no lo coloque bien, me dices donde tiene que ir en el código.

Muchas gracias.
  #5 (permalink)  
Antiguo 05/01/2005, 06:58
Avatar de RUX
RUX
 
Fecha de Ingreso: enero-2004
Ubicación: Las Palmas de Gran Canari
Mensajes: 566
Antigüedad: 20 años, 3 meses
Puntos: 0
Holas,,, prueba a crear una tabla normal y corriente que ocupe toda la pagina (osea que contenga el parametro width="100%" y height="100%") y luego dentro de esa tabla, introduces la que ya tienes o creas otra y a esa es a la que le tienes que añadir el valign="middle".

Ejemplo:
Código HTML:
<table width="100%" height="100%" border="0" cellpadding="0" cellspacing="0">
    <tr>
      <td><table width="100%" border="0" valign="middle" align="center" cellpadding="2" cellspacing="2">
        <tr>
          <td width="10%">...etc...
SALUDOS y suerte!! ;)
__________________
Rux.es - Sitio Personal | IslaRock.com - Todo Rock
  #6 (permalink)  
Antiguo 07/01/2005, 01:23
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
hola rux, perdona que te vuelva a molestar, pero he hecho lo que decías, pero sigue sin funcionar, no se pq. Fijaté que esto es lo que he puesto a ver si encuentras algo que no vaya bien. Muchas gracias.

Ten en cuenta que dentro de la tabla lo que hay es el flash.


<table width="100%" height="100%" border="0" cellpadding="0" cellspacing="0">
<tr>
<td><table width="100%" border="0" valign="middle" align="center" cellspacing="2" cellpadding="2">
<tr>
<td><object class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000" codebase="http://fpdownload.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=6,0,0,0" width="755" height="440" id="principal_futuro" align="middle">
<param name="allowScriptAccess" value="sameDomain" />
<param name="movie" value="principal_futuro.swf" />
<param name="quality" value="high" />
<param name="bgcolor" value="#1f3c76" />
<embed src="principal_futuro.swf" quality="high" bgcolor="#1f3c76" width="755" height="440" name="principal_futuro" align="middle" allowscriptaccess="sameDomain" type="application/x-shockwave-flash" pluginspage="http://www.macromedia.com/go/getflashplayer" />
</object></td>
</tr>
</table>
</td>
</tr>
</table>
  #7 (permalink)  
Antiguo 07/01/2005, 01:46
 
Fecha de Ingreso: abril-2004
Mensajes: 13
Antigüedad: 20 años
Puntos: 0
valign

Cerberus8,

La que tiene que tener el valign es la siguiente:

<td><table width="100%" border="0" valign="middle" align="center" cellspacing="2" cellpadding="2">
<tr>
<td valign="middle">

Espero te sirva,

Julius Barber
  #8 (permalink)  
Antiguo 07/01/2005, 02:49
 
Fecha de Ingreso: julio-2004
Mensajes: 64
Antigüedad: 19 años, 9 meses
Puntos: 0
Hola Cerberus8, esta es la solución: en el <DT> de la tabla exterior, que contiene la tabla que te interesa tienes que alinear su contenido al centro (aling=”center”) yo también lo he alineado arriba pero eso lo puedes quitar. Despues, la tabla que te interesa tiene que tener un ancho que sea visible con una resolución de 800 x 600 pixels, por ejemplo width="755". He usado 755 porque veo que el ancho del objeto que has insertado es ese, pero puede variar (si lo aumentas ten cuidado de que con una resolución de 800 x 600 pixels no te aparezca el Scroll horizontal).
Saludos.
Aquí tienes el código:

<table width="100%" height="100%" border="0" cellpadding="0" cellspacing="0">
<tr>
<td aling="center" valign="top">
<table width="755" border="0" valign="middle" align="center" cellspacing="2" cellpadding="2">
<tr>
<td><object class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000" codebase="http://fpdownload.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=6,0,0,0" width="755" height="440" id="principal_futuro" align="middle">
<param name="allowScriptAccess" value="sameDomain" />
<param name="movie" value="principal_futuro.swf" />
<param name="quality" value="high" />
<param name="bgcolor" value="#1f3c76" />
<embed src="principal_futuro.swf" quality="high" bgcolor="#1f3c76" width="755" height="440" name="principal_futuro" align="middle" allowscriptaccess="sameDomain" type="application/x-shockwave-flash" pluginspage="http://www.macromedia.com/go/getflashplayer" />
</object>
</td>
</tr>
</table>
</td>
</tr>
</table>
  #9 (permalink)  
Antiguo 07/01/2005, 03:28
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
nada, no consigo nada, solo consigo centrarlo de izquierda a derecha, pero no se me centra de arriba a abajo.

Si quieren les mando el flash y ustedes ven si pueden centrarlo

aquí les dejo de todas formas el código:

<body bgcolor="#1f3c76">

<!--URL utilizadas en la película-->
<a href="mailto: [email protected]"></a>
<a href="enviarestapagina.html"></a>
<a href="eda.html"></a>
<a href="productos.html"></a>
<a href="http://correo.autoeda.com/exchange"></a>
<a href="oferteda.html"></a>
<a href="trabaja.html"></a>
<a href="cliente.html"></a>
<!--Texto utilizado en la película-->

<table width="100%" height="100%" border="0" cellpadding="0" cellspacing="0">
<tr>
<td aling="center" valign="top">
<table width= 755 border="0" valign="middle" align="center" cellspacing="2" cellpadding="2">
<tr>
<td valign="middle">

<object class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000"

codebase="http://fpdownload.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=6,0,0,0" width="755" height="440"

id="principal_futuro" align="middle">
<param name="allowScriptAccess" value="sameDomain" />
<param name="movie" value="principal_futuro.swf" />
<param name="quality" value="high" />
<param name="bgcolor" value="#1f3c76" />
<embed src="principal_futuro.swf" quality="high" bgcolor="#1f3c76" width="755" height="440" name="principal_futuro"

align="middle" allowScriptAccess="sameDomain" type="application/x-shockwave-flash"

pluginspage="http://www.macromedia.com/go/getflashplayer" />
</object>

</td>
</tr>
</table>
</td>
</tr>
</table>

</body>


Muchas gracias por la ayuda que me están prestando
  #10 (permalink)  
Antiguo 07/01/2005, 03:35
 
Fecha de Ingreso: abril-2004
Mensajes: 13
Antigüedad: 20 años
Puntos: 0
Por lo visto no hiciste lo que te mencione, prueba lo que puse porque ya hice una pruena y me funciono bien, que pases un buen dia,

Julius Barber
  #11 (permalink)  
Antiguo 07/01/2005, 03:48
 
Fecha de Ingreso: abril-2004
Mensajes: 185
Antigüedad: 20 años
Puntos: 0
No sera que estas viendo la pagina de la cache y por eso no ves cambios?
__________________
Recologic
  #12 (permalink)  
Antiguo 07/01/2005, 03:57
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
slogica esto es lo que me dijiste no?

<table width="100%" height="100%" border="0" cellpadding="0" cellspacing="0">
<tr>
<td aling="center" valign="top">
<table width= "755" border="0" valign="middle" align="center" cellspacing="2" cellpadding="2">
<tr>
<td>

<object class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000"

codebase="http://fpdownload.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=6,0,0,0" width="755" height="440"

id="principal_futuro" align="middle">
<param name="allowScriptAccess" value="sameDomain" />
<param name="movie" value="principal_futuro.swf" />
<param name="quality" value="high" />
<param name="bgcolor" value="#1f3c76" />
<embed src="principal_futuro.swf" quality="high" bgcolor="#1f3c76" width="755" height="440" name="principal_futuro"

align="middle" allowScriptAccess="sameDomain" type="application/x-shockwave-flash"

pluginspage="http://www.macromedia.com/go/getflashplayer" />
</object>

</td>
</tr>
</table>
</td>
</tr>
</table>
  #13 (permalink)  
Antiguo 07/01/2005, 04:10
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
papitu lo de la cache no puede ser, pq si veo cambios, lo que pasa es que no son los que espero.

Muchas gracias
  #14 (permalink)  
Antiguo 07/01/2005, 04:16
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
slogica, si hice lo que me indicaste, este es el código según entendí yo, el de antes era para enocturnas.
Lo que pasa que tu código no me lo centra ni siquiera de izquierda a derecha.
Cual puede ser el motivo que yo lo vea y tú no?

Muchas gracias por todas las molestias

<table width="100%" height="100%" border="0" cellpadding="0" cellspacing="0">
<tr>
<td>
<table width= 100% border="0" valign="middle" align="center" cellspacing="2" cellpadding="2">
<tr>
<td valign = "middle">

<object class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000"

codebase="http://fpdownload.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=6,0,0,

0" width="755" height="440" id="principal_futuro" align="middle">
<param name="allowScriptAccess" value="sameDomain" />
<param name="movie" value="principal_futuro.swf" />
<param name="quality" value="high" />
<param name="bgcolor" value="#1f3c76" />
<embed src="principal_futuro.swf" quality="high" bgcolor="#1f3c76" width="755" height="440"

name="principal_futuro" align="middle" allowScriptAccess="sameDomain"

type="application/x-shockwave-flash" pluginspage="http://www.macromedia.com/go/getflashplayer"

/>
</object>

</td>
</tr>
</table>
</td>
</tr>
</table>
  #15 (permalink)  
Antiguo 07/01/2005, 05:45
 
Fecha de Ingreso: julio-2004
Mensajes: 64
Antigüedad: 19 años, 9 meses
Puntos: 0
Hola Cerberus8 Con este código tu flash queda centrado para cualquier resolución tanto a lo ancho como a lo alto, pruebalo:
Saludos .

<table width="100%" height="100%" border="0" cellpadding="0" cellspacing="0">
<tr>
<td aling="center" valign="middle">
<table width="755" border="0" valign="middle" align="center" cellspacing="2" cellpadding="2">
<tr>
<td>
<object class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000" codebase="http://fpdownload.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=6,0,0,0" width="755" height="440" id="principal_futuro" align="middle">
<param name="allowScriptAccess" value="sameDomain" />
<param name="movie" value="principal_futuro.swf" />
<param name="quality" value="high" />
<param name="bgcolor" value="#1f3c76" />
<embed src="principal_futuro.swf" quality="high" bgcolor="#1f3c76" width="755" height="440" name="principal_futuro" align="middle" allowscriptaccess="sameDomain" type="application/x-shockwave-flash" pluginspage="http://www.macromedia.com/go/getflashplayer" />
</object>
</td>
</tr>
</table>
</td>
</tr>
</table>
  #16 (permalink)  
Antiguo 07/01/2005, 06:04
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
lo siento enocturnas, a lo ancho si, a lo alto no
te mando un mail con ello y lo pruebas tu, dame tu mail
  #17 (permalink)  
Antiguo 10/01/2005, 03:56
 
Fecha de Ingreso: julio-2004
Mensajes: 64
Antigüedad: 19 años, 9 meses
Puntos: 0
Hola Cerberus8, como te he dicho por correo electrónico el problema está en las dos líneas que tienes al principio del fichero HTML. Si las borras, el flash queda centrado.

Dichas líneas son: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

Entérate de como te afecta el borrarlas, he visto que aquí hablan de ello: http://www.forosdelweb.com/showthrea...ght=www.w3.org

Saludos
  #18 (permalink)  
Antiguo 10/01/2005, 04:41
 
Fecha de Ingreso: diciembre-2004
Mensajes: 44
Antigüedad: 19 años, 4 meses
Puntos: 0
Creo que se cual es tu problema

Creo que es mas sencillo que todo eso, prueba poniendo el valign en el TR
<tr valign="middel">
  #19 (permalink)  
Antiguo 10/01/2005, 08:26
 
Fecha de Ingreso: julio-2004
Mensajes: 64
Antigüedad: 19 años, 9 meses
Puntos: 0
Hola gaspampera.
Se escribe "middle", pero de todas formas el problema consiste en que con las línea "<!DOCTYPE...", la celda no acepta el height="100%". Realmente el flash siempre está centrado pero al no ser la tabla lo suficientemente grande, no lo vemos...
  #20 (permalink)  
Antiguo 10/01/2005, 10:20
Avatar de KnowDemon  
Fecha de Ingreso: julio-2004
Ubicación: Ciudad de México
Mensajes: 544
Antigüedad: 19 años, 9 meses
Puntos: 2
No, no no, no, no!!!!!!

No quiten el DOCTYPE!!!!!

Es verdad que algunas cosas funcionan diferente con él... pero no funcionan mal. ¡Funcionan como deben de funcionar! Y no, el DOCTYPE NO GENERA PROBLEMAS, el poblema es nuestra falta de conocimento del HTML, las CSS, y los estándares.

¿Quieres centrar una web a lo ancho y a lo alto usando el DOCTYPE y siguiendo estrictamente las especificiones XHTML y CSS? Aquí está la solución:

http://www.tierradenomadas.com/tw003.phtml

Te aconsejo que lo leas completo.

Según el tipo de web que tengas utilizarás alguno de los métodos de centrado que están ahí. Veras que utilizar CSS da un código mucho más limpio y fácil de mantener.
__________________
Mi pequeño espacio en la web: VisiónE
"El cosmos es todo lo que es, todo lo que fue, y todo lo que será alguna vez."

Última edición por KnowDemon; 10/01/2005 a las 10:25
  #21 (permalink)  
Antiguo 11/01/2005, 10:36
 
Fecha de Ingreso: octubre-2003
Mensajes: 392
Antigüedad: 20 años, 6 meses
Puntos: 1
KnowDemon no niego que CSS sea muy bueno, pero la verdad es que no lo he usado nunca y ni siquiera se donde tendría que poner las sentencias <div>.
No hay otra forma? Muchas gracias.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 22:21.